Bobby Pinn is a spiky haired, animated, friendly and thoroughly knowledgeable guide. He is well suited to conducting this tour as he looks like a rock star himself. I took my 18 year-old daughter on the tour in August 2008 and we both enjoyed it despite the fact that she hadn't heard of a lot of the bands and artists. If you are into punk rock especially I would heartily recommend it. Bobby is very thorough and entertaining in his delivery and invites questions so don't hold back. There are many bars and eateries en route, some of which Bobby recommends. We particularly liked the fashion shops and at the end of the tour I would urge anyone to visit Trash and Vaudeville which is at the beginning of the route. The tour ends at the former CBGBs, now a gallery, and that's also worth a look. The staff in there are also very helpful and friendly. One piece of advice though: the tour is 2 hours long and we went in sweltering heat, so wear comfortable clothes and shoes.

I registered my son and I for the tour. My son digs the Ramones, the Clash and other punk groups and the tour hit many places of interest for him, especially the Joe Strummer memorial. I liked the broad rock and punk history that occurred in such a small enclave of the city; just a little more detail in a city filled with so many minute interests. The tour was also interesting on a personal and a professional level regarding the architecture of the neighborhood and the long transition its been going through with the evils of gentrification. The guide was knowledgeable regarding the local scene, the GG Allin tale a particularly good one. My son knew it all already though, but he liked relating it to where it happened. The tour was definitiely a highlight of our visit to the city.
